下面是SQL在一个表中添加字段并添加备注的方法的完整攻略:
步骤1:使用ALTER TABLE语句添加字段
在SQL中,您可以使用ALTER TABLE语句添加一个新的字段。该语句的基本语法如下:
ALTER TABLE table_name
ADD column_name column-definition;
- table_name:要添加新字段的表的名称。
- column_name:要添加到表中的新字段的名称。
- column-definition:新字段的数据类型和任何其他属性(如默认值)。
下面是一个详细的示例用法:
ALTER TABLE customers
ADD email VARCHAR(255) NOT NULL;
这个示例向一个名为"customers"的表中添加了一个名为"email"的字段。该字段被指定为VARCHAR(255)数据类型并被标记为NOT NULL(即不能为空)。
步骤2:使用COMMENT语句对字段添加备注
为了给新添加的字段添加注释,在ALTER TABLE语句后面添加一个COMMENT语句:
ALTER TABLE table_name
ADD column_name column-definition COMMENT 'comment';
其中'comment'是您添加的注释文本。下面是一个示例用法:
ALTER TABLE customers
ADD email VARCHAR(255) NOT NULL COMMENT 'The customer\'s email address.';
这个示例添加了一个名为"email"的字段,并为该字段添加了注释,该注释描述了该字段的用途。
示例说明
示例1:将订单表添加字段
下面是一个示例。我们要在orders表中添加一个名为"is_paid"的布尔字段,该字段用于存储订单是否已付款:
ALTER TABLE orders
ADD is_paid BOOLEAN NOT NULL COMMENT 'Whether or not the order has been paid.';
这个示例在orders表中添加了一个布尔字段,并为该字段添加了注释,以解释其具体含义。
示例2:向产品表添加一列
假设我们有一个名为products的表,其中包含产品名称和价格的列表。我们想将该表添加一列,用于存储每种商品的库存量。
ALTER TABLE products
ADD stock INT NOT NULL COMMENT 'The current stock level for this product.';
这个示例在products表中添加了一列,并为该列添加了注释以解释其用途。
总之,这就是如何在SQL中添加一个新的字段并添加注释的详细过程。
本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:sql在一个表中添加字段并添加备注的方法 - Python技术站